Output 6c5008c535e154e3065a8701b99106f5da9c068854a0a04ba0c9b66b2af36543:1

value
4237396764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d89ecd1938a3d769eb0500a9a36d0a5872099023 OP_EQUAL
address
3MSQ7gFdMbDVntxu9XKL2bUD6gx3F5TjaA
transaction
6c5008c535e154e3065a8701b99106f5da9c068854a0a04ba0c9b66b2af36543
confirmations
506343
spent
true